Sluggish throttle response?

My car was getting lazy and I kept resetting the computer every few weeks to compensate. Finally got around to cleaning my MAF last night, what a difference. Car is shifting and responding like new. I guess the moral of the story is cleaning it out everytime you do an oil change.

This is so easy, even a caveman can do it.

Pull your airbox, release the retaining clip and pull the MAF, disconnect the harness and clean with MAF cleaner. Reinstall.
